For heads of department: the Q4 forecast for Meridale Group projects closing cash of 3.1m, broadly flat quarter-on-quarter. Inflows benefit from the Penhallow contract milestone, offset by capital spend on the Larkspur facility upgrade. Receivables ageing has improved; payables terms unchanged. Downside scenario assumes a one-month slip on Penhallow, reducing closing cash by 400k. Department submissions for the next cycle are due in two weeks. A confidential note on business plans follows below.

management briefing: Project Ulavan slips by two quarters because of the staffing delay.

Handover note — Crumbwheel order cutoffs.

Welcome aboard. The bakery cutoff rule in Crumbwheel closes same-day orders at 14:00 local to each storefront, not UTC — this has bitten us twice. Holiday overrides live in the calendar service and take precedence silently, so always check there first when a cutoff looks wrong. To unlock the calendar service's admin console after a restart, enter the recovery passphrase below.

vault phrase of bagap-bahaf = silion-pelox-sorox-casdor-quenwyn-fraax-eliox-praael-kelion-quenvan-kasox-rusael-norius-belvan

Board Briefing — Q3 Budget Request

Velmora Systems requests an additional allocation of 1.2M to accelerate the Corvid platform rollout across the Hallenport region. Spend is weighted toward tooling and contractor hours, with quarterly checkpoints and a clawback clause. Finance has reviewed the assumptions. The following note outlines the strategic rationale in confidence.

internal memo for taguf-kafop: Novmirax Group plans to lower the Oliius list price by 42.0 percent in March. The board signed off on a budget of $367.8 million for Project Belael. The renewal with Drumirax Logistics closes at $302.4 million a year, 54.0 percent below the last contract. Project Kelys slips by a full year because of the staffing delay.

CI note for review: the Skellridge bloom filter sits in front of the Varnmoor KV store to skip lookups for absent keys. Test flake traced to the filter being rebuilt with a different seed per CI shard, so negative lookups leaked through inconsistently. Fix pins the seed in the pipeline config. Security-relevant: the seed is not secret and carries no key material; false-positive rate stays at 0.1%. No timing channel identified. Verified against the hardened build, token below.

build token for yajof-bajof: htk31_506ff1188f74596b5bb2eec94edc43c